Hey there! In this video im going to explain how you can insert badges using different markup languages such as: Textile, RST, Markdown or HTML. The first point that we should understand is that there is no specific syntax for a badge or a shield in any of those markup languages, so something that we should figure out is what is actually a badge? Well, for doing such thing lets go to shields.io and create a simple static badge with just hardcoded information, lets take something that Ive used before to create the same kind of badges, and Make badge. What weve got here is a source link and this mysterious output element which is called Badge. Lets inspect it and what we can see here is just an SVG or Scalable Vector Graphics.
